How much do part time custodial jobs pay per hour?

As of May 28, 2026, the average hourly pay for part time custodial in North Carolina is $15.14,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.75 and $16.59 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Part Time Custodial worker,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part Time Custodial worker, you need knowledge of cleaning techniques, basic maintenance skills, and often a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with cleaning equipment, chemical handling, and safety protocols is typically required. Reliability, attention to detail, and good time management help custodians stand out in maintaining clean and safe environments. These skills ensure efficient facility upkeep, health standards compliance, and a positive experience for building occupants.

What are some typical challenges faced by part-time custodial workers, and how can they be managed?

Part-time custodial workers often face challenges such as managing time efficiently to complete required tasks within shorter shifts, adapting to varying cleaning schedules, and occasionally responding to urgent maintenance needs. Staying organized, prioritizing tasks, and communicating proactively with supervisors and team members can help manage these challenges. Many custodial teams also provide training on safe equipment use and cleaning protocols, which supports a smooth workflow and helps new employees acclimate quickly.

What are part time custodial jobs?

Part time custodial jobs involve cleaning and maintaining buildings such as schools, offices, hospitals, or public facilities, typically for fewer hours than a full-time position. Duties often include sweeping, mopping, dusting, emptying trash, restocking supplies, and sometimes minor maintenance tasks. Part time custodians may work evenings, early mornings, or weekends depending on the facility's needs, making this a flexible option for those seeking supplemental income. These roles are essential for keeping environments safe, clean, and welcoming for occupants and visitors.

What is the difference between Part Time Custodial vs Part Time Janitorial?

AspectPart Time CustodialPart Time Janitorial
CredentialsNone typically requiredNone typically required
Work EnvironmentSchools, offices, public buildingsSchools, offices, public buildings
Employer UsageCommonly used in schools and commercial facilitiesCommonly used in schools and commercial facilities
Job FocusCleaning, maintenance, basic repairsCleaning, sanitation, minor repairs

Part Time Custodial and Part Time Janitorial roles are similar, often overlapping in work environment and duties. Both involve cleaning and maintenance tasks in schools and commercial settings, with minimal credentials required. The terms are sometimes used interchangeably, but 'Custodial' may emphasize broader maintenance responsibilities, while 'Janitorial' focuses more on cleaning and sanitation.
